Ada L Parnell     abt 1870  Wellingborough, Northamptonshire, England  Nurse     Rushden  Northamptonshire     
Albert Whitney    abt 1871 Raunds, Northamptonshire, England Head    Rushden Northamptonshire    
Raymond Whitney   abt 1896 Higham Ferrers, Northamptonshire, England Son    Rushden Northamptonshire    
Rose Whitney abt 1870    Higham Ferrers, Northamptonshire, England Wife    Rushden Northamptonshire    

On the census form it has pressman I think it says Boot and after that leather. So you are right he was a shoemaker  It has Ada Parnell a "sick nurse"

I think it says 4 Winchester Road for their address Parish of Rushden St Marys.
